How to buy WINkLink (WIN) coins safely and reliably
To secure your WIN investment, opt for reputable exchanges like Binance that prioritize regulatory compliance, robust security measures, ample trading volume, and competitive fees.

WINkLink (WIN) is a native token of the TRON-based gaming platform, WINk. It empowers network users to participate in gaming tournaments, access exclusive rewards, cast votes on game proposals, and generate passive income through staking. However, navigating the crypto market to purchase WIN requires a methodical approach that prioritizes security and reliability. This comprehensive guide will provide a step-by-step breakdown of the process, ensuring that you make informed decisions and safeguard your funds.
Step 1: Choose a Reputable Cryptocurrency ExchangeSelecting the right cryptocurrency exchange is paramount to ensuring the security and reliability of your WIN purchase. Consider the following factors when making your decision:
- Regulatory compliance: Choose an exchange regulated by reputable financial authorities to ensure adherence to industry best practices and customer protection.
- Security measures: Evaluate the exchange's security infrastructure, including encryption standards, two-factor authentication (2FA), and insurance policies.
- Trading volume: Ensure the exchange has sufficient trading volume in WIN to facilitate your purchase without significant slippage or delays.
- Fees: Compare transaction fees and withdrawal fees across different exchanges to minimize costs.
Recommended Exchanges: Binance, KuCoin, Huobi, OKX
Step 2: Create and Verify Your Exchange AccountOnce you have selected an exchange, you will need to create and verify your account. This typically involves providing personal information, email address, and phone number. Follow the exchange's instructions to complete the verification process, which may require uploading government-issued identification documents.
Step 3: Fund Your Exchange AccountThere are several options for funding your exchange account:
- Bank transfer: Wire funds directly from your bank account. This method may take a few business days to process.
- Credit/debit card: Purchase WIN using your credit or debit card for near-instant availability. Card transactions typically incur higher fees.
- Cryptocurrency deposit: Transfer existing cryptocurrency holdings from a personal wallet or another exchange into your exchange account.
With your exchange account funded, you can now place an order to buy WIN coins. There are two main types of orders:
- Market order: Executes immediately at the current market price, ensuring the swiftest acquisition of WIN. However, it may result in a slightly less favorable price than a limit order.
- Limit order: Specifies the maximum price you are willing to pay for WIN. The order is filled only if the market price falls to or below the specified limit, enabling you to lock in a more advantageous price.
Once your WIN purchase is complete, you will need to store your coins securely to prevent theft or loss. Consider the following options:
- Hardware wallet: A dedicated hardware device designed to securely store private keys offline, offering the highest level of protection.
- Software wallet: A digital wallet stored on your computer or mobile device, providing convenience but with lower security than hardware wallets.
- Exchange wallet: Keep your WIN on the exchange where you purchased them, balancing accessibility with potential exposure to security breaches.
